Modi to tour Kutch tomorrow
Ahmedabad, Dec 17 (UNI)Gujarat Chief Minister Narendra Modi will tour Kutch district tomorrow and inaugurate the 'Guide' international seminar at 0900 hrs which will see over 120 environmentalists, scientists and green activists, including 20 from overseas, participate in the three-day regional conference focusing on increasing desertification and its serious fallouts.
After inauguration of the seminar, Modi will reach Jhakhau where he will dedicate a fisheries harbour port to the fishermen. He then will proceed to Netra to lay the foundation stone for a water supply project that will supply Narmada water to western parts of Kutch. He will then go Bhuj to inaugurate a new Collectorate building and a central prison. He is then slated to attend the ''Chintan Shibir'' for district officials.
